The Carbon Hoofprint: Animal Agriculture’s Contribution to Greenhouse Gases
Think of it as the “carbon hoofprint.”
Animal agriculture, particularly livestock farming, is a substantial contributor to greenhouse gas emissions.
Methane comes mostly from cows. Yes, those cow burps and farts are real!
Nitrous oxide mainly comes from the use of manure and fertilisers for animal feed.
These gases are much more potent than carbon dioxide. Therefore, their impact on global warming is significantly greater.

Energy Efficiency in Food Production: Plants vs. Animals
Making animal protein uses much more energy and creates more emissions than growing the same amount of plant protein.
Animals must consume a large amount of plants and drink a significant amount of water. They also need large spaces to produce a small amount of protein that we can eat. Plants convert sunlight into food directly and do it more efficiently.
The Role of Land Use Change and Deforestation in Emissions
The need for grazing lands and animal feed crops often causes deforestation.
Cutting down forests releases stored carbon. This increases greenhouse gas emissions.
Choosing a plant-based diet cuts emissions from livestock. It also helps protect essential carbon sinks, such as forests.

The Thirsty Business of Animal Agriculture: Water Footprint Explained
The Thirsty Business of Animal Agriculture: Water Footprint Explained
The “water footprint” of our food includes all the water used in its production. This covers everything from growing crops to processing and packaging them.
And here’s the eye-opener: animal agriculture is an incredibly thirsty business.
Consider all the water that livestock drink.
Then, consider the substantial amounts required to produce their feed, such as corn and soy. Also, water is necessary for cleaning their facilities.
For instance, making one kilogram of beef can use thousands of litres of water. That’s a considerable amount, especially when you think about global consumption!
Comparing Water Consumption: Plant-Based Foods vs. Animal Products
In stark contrast, most plant-based foods have a significantly smaller water footprint.
Growing a kilogram of lentils or vegetables needs far less water than producing a kilogram of meat.
This difference isn’t only about drinking water. It’s also about easing the tremendous stress on our world’s water supply for irrigation.
Water Pollution from Agricultural Runoff: An Overlooked Ecological Impact
What’s more, intensive farming practices often lead to water pollution.
Runoff from farms carries fertilisers, pesticides, and animal waste. This can pollute rivers, lakes, and groundwater. This pollution harms aquatic ecosystems and can pose risks to human health.

The Ecological Cost of Habitat Destruction for Animal Agriculture
Where do we find the ample land needed for grazing livestock? What about the huge fields for feed crops like soy and corn?
All too often, it comes at the expense of natural habitats.
Animal agriculture is a significant contributor to deforestation and habitat loss worldwide.
When loggers cut down forests or developers convert grasslands, many species lose their habitats. This leads to extinction for some.
Biodiversity loss weakens ecosystems. This makes them less able to handle climate change and other stressors. It’s a significant ecological cost that often goes unseen.
Land Use Efficiency: Growing More Food on Less Land with Plant-Based Systems
However, here’s where plant-based eating truly excels in terms of land-use efficiency.
Growing plants for protein and calories needs much less land than raising animals for the same amount.
For every calorie of meat produced, farmers need to grow many more calories of feed crops.
Removing the “middle animal” can significantly reduce the land needed to feed us. We can grow more food on less land. This frees up important areas for rewilding or other sustainable uses.

Manure Management and Its Environmental Challenges
One major challenge stems from manure management on large-scale animal farms.
Animal waste can be overwhelming. It can pollute natural systems and cause serious problems.
Runoff can carry waste, extra nutrients, and harmful bacteria. This contamination can pollute rivers and lakes. It creates “dead zones” where aquatic life cannot survive.
Also, the breakdown of manure releases harmful gases. This adds to local air pollution.
Antibiotic Use and Resistance in Animal Agriculture: An Ecological Threat
Then there’s the issue of antibiotic use.
Farmers often give livestock a high dose of antibiotics. This helps prevent diseases in crowded spaces and promotes growth.
Antibiotic resistance is a global issue. It poses serious risks to both public health and the environment. Resistant bacteria can spread easily, causing widespread problems.
Pesticide and Fertiliser Use in Feed Crop Production: Ecological Ramifications
Growing feed crops for animals often relies heavily on synthetic fertilisers and pesticides.
These chemicals can seep into the soil and water. This harms helpful insects and wildlife. It can also affect our drinking water.
